Forum: Mikrocontroller und Digitale Elektronik AVR Library


von Alexander Jung (Gast)


Lesenswert?

Hallo,

Kann mir jemand mit links bzw. selbstentwickelten libraries für 64 bit 
(double precision) floating point arithmetic im CodeVision AVR Compiler 
weiterhelfen ?


mfg ALEX

von Matthias (Gast)


Lesenswert?

Hi

für was um alles in der Welt braucht man double auf einem 8Bitter? Mache 
dir erstmal Gedanken über den Algorithmus und ob sich der nicht mit 
float oder sogar (viel besser) mit Fixkomma/Ganzzahl-Arithmetik 
erschlagen läßt.

Matthias

von Oliver (Gast)


Lesenswert?

Hallo,
ja das würde mich auch mal WIRKLICH interessieren, wofür man
64 Bit floating point braucht. Soll kein Vorwurf sein! Nur reine 
Neugierde.

Grüße
Oliver

von Alexander Jung (Gast)


Lesenswert?

Hi,

64 bit floating point macht dann sinn, wenn man
die inverse einer 4x4 matrix mit floating point
elementen sucht und das mit einem fehler <= 1 lsb

hab leider bis jetzt keinen realisierbaren Algorithmus,
der mit einfacher float Genauigkeit funktioniert, gefunden.

mfg ALEX

von Norbert (Gast)


Lesenswert?

Mir wäre es recht, wenn es für 8-Bitter wenigstens float-Berechnungen 
mit 6-stelliger Genauigkeit geben würde.

CodeVision macht da nur 5-stellige Genauigkeit.

Die Hardware(z.B. mega128) wird immer komfortabler, nur die Compiler 
erreichen hier nichtmals ANSI-Standard.

So bin ich eben auf 'nen 16-Bitter umgestiegen.

Norbert

von siliconburner (Gast)


Lesenswert?

no lib dann selbst proggen in asm ;)

Bitte melde dich an um einen Beitrag zu schreiben. Anmeldung ist kostenlos und dauert nur eine Minute.
Bestehender Account
Schon ein Account bei Google/GoogleMail? Keine Anmeldung erforderlich!
Mit Google-Account einloggen
Noch kein Account? Hier anmelden.